103 Things to Do in Austin, TX

2. Learn the story of Texas at the Bob Bullock Museum
3. Take a cool, refreshing dip in Barton Springs pool
4. Tour the Capital building
5. Go windsurfing or wakeboarding on Lake Travis
6. Glide through Town lake on a rented canoe
7. Savor a bowl of Amy’s ice cream
8. Tour the city’s art galleries
9. See the entire city from the University of Texas clock tower
10. Sift through 10,000 bizarre trinkets and gadgets at Toy Joy
11 Ridicule bad movies along with live comedians at the Alamo Drafthouse’s Master Pancake Theater
12. Wolf down a stack of delicious pancakes at Kerby Lane Cafe
13. Pick your favorite suite at the historic Hotel San Jose
14. Dance to live music and meet local artists while you shop on South Congress on the first Thursday of every month
15. Run (or walk) the Keep Austin Weird 5k
16. Watch the sun go down over the lake on the deck at the Oasis
17. Catch a live comedy show at Cap City Comedy Club
18. Try on a crazy costume at Lucy in Disguise with Diamonds
19. Visit the giant statue of Stevie Ray Vaughan
20. Cheer with a crowd at a UT Longhorns football game
21. Join 75,000 of your closest friends at the 3-day Austin City Limits Music Festival every fall
22. Get a picture with Leslie Cochran
23. Argue over where to find the cheapest breakfast taco
24.Dip your chip in a bowl of Mag Mud at Magnolia Cafe
25. Picnic on Sunday at Waterloo Park
26. Walk, jog, or ride your bike over more than ten miles of trails at Town Lake
27. Run wild and free with your puppy off the leash at one of Austin’s many dog parks
28. Bicycle on scenic Loop 360
29. Splash around while you watch a movie in the water at Deep Eddy Pool’s Splash Party movie nights all summer long
30. Watch a million bats stream out from under the Congress Ave. bridge, the largest urban bat colony in North America
31. Count the steps to the top of Mt. Bonnell and enjoy the panoramic views of Austin
32. Catch a cool breeze from Lake Austin on the wide deck of Mozart’s Coffee
33. Find a shadowy corner and listen to jazz at the Elephant Room
34. Pick out a new CD at Waterloo Records
35. Laugh until you cry at Esther’s Follies, a variety show with music parodies, hilarious sketches, political satire, and magic
36. Take a free tour of the elegant governor’s mansion
37. Shake your feathers with roaming peacocks at Mayfield Park
38. Get up early on Saturday morning to buy locally grown goodies at the Austin Farmer’s Market downtown
39. Sip an iced coffee on a warm night at the Spiderhouse Cafe’s twinkling outdoor patio
40. Find the moonlight towers
41. Spend a day touring the LBJ Library and Museum, the largest presidential library in the nation
42. Eat popcorn to all your favorite old movies during the historic Paramount Theater’s Summer Film Classics Series
43. Treat the kids to a fun afternoon at the Austin Children’s Museum
44. Order a cocktail at the luxurious Driskill Hotel
45. Relax, rest your tired feet and ride in comfort for free on the downtown ‘Dillo trolley cars
46. Discover a Hill Country winery
47. Find a funky shop along “The Drag” (Guadalupe St. running beside the UT campus)
48. Go all natural at the expansive Whole Foods World Headquarters
49. Two-step the night away at the Broken Spoke
50. Feed the body and the soul at a Sunday gospel brunch, either at Stubb’s Barbeque or Threadgill’s Home Cookin’
51. Cozy up in an armchair and read at BookPeople
52. Join the crowd for a big concert at the Frank Erwin Center
53. Pay your respects to many legendary Texas politicians and heroes at the beautiful and serene Texas State Cemetery
54. Hike, bike, climb, swim, picnic, walk, run, disc-golf, and ride the kiddie train, all on sprawling Zilker Park’s 351 acres
55. Marvel at the unique architecture of the Frost Bank Tower downtown
56. Sing the blues at the legendary Antone’s
57. Head a little south of town to New Braunfels and brave the giant tubes and slides at Schlitterbahn Water Park
58. Take a scenic hike at Emma Long Metropolitan Park
59. Revel in the sweet sounds of the Austin Lyric Opera
60. Embarass your out-of-town visitors and sing along at Pete’s Dueling Piano bar on Sixth Street
61. Dance Salsa!
62. Have your martini shaken, not stirred at a swanky bar in the trendy Warehouse District downtown
63. Shiver your way through an Austin Ghost Tour
64. Reserve a front-row seat for a play at the Zachary Scott Theater
65. Find your favorite local microbrewery
66. Tiptoe into a Ballet Austin Show
67. See the 600-year-old Treaty Oak tree
68. Meet a sweet senior citizen at the Old Bakery and Emporium
69. Get lost in the enormous Blanton Museum of Art
70. Throw a long shot at Pease Park’s disc golf course
71. Choose from 80 different draft beers at the Ginger Man Pub
72. Explore the trails and beautiful art at the Umlauf Sculpture Garden
73. Grab a tasty sandwhich at the the Little Deli but first ask for Tony, tell him Matt sent you, and you want the special
74. Adopt a pet from the Town Lake Animal Center
75. Give in to a decadent dessert at Chez Zee American Bistro
76. Make your own independent film or just pick your favorite at one of Austin’s many annual film festivals
77. Rock out at SXSW Music festival every March
78. Befriend a lion at the Austin Zoo
79. Go back in time at the Jourdan-Bachman Pioneer Farms
80. Say bonjour to the French Legation, the oldest building in Austin
81. Cheer for your favorite Texas roller derby girl
82. Grab a pint at Scholz Garten, the oldest business in Austin
83. Build a bike from scraps at the Yellow Bike Project
84. Celebrate Eeyore’s birthday party
85. Rollerblade down the Veloway
86. Line up your best shot at Buffalo Billards
87. Rent an interesting film at I Love Video or Vulcan Video
88. Take a load off on the beach at Hippie Hollow
89. Sip on a bottle of locally-made Sweet Leaf Tea
90. Catch a fly ball in the stands at a Round Rock Express game
91. Order a big plate of enchiladas while you dine in the hubcap room at Chuy’s
92. Shop ’til you drop at the Domain
93. Frolick with your kids in the fountains at Southpark Meadows
94. Lick barbeque sauce off your fingers at the Salt Lick
95. Discover the underworld at Inner Space Caverns
96. Play bingo with live chickens at Ginny’s Little Longhorn Saloon
97. Spend the whole weekend at the Old Pecan Street Festival
98. Visit the Elisabet Ney Museum in Hyde Park
99. Bring your dog and enjoy delicious food or drink at Freddie’s Place
100. Test your wits at the annual O. Henry Pun-Off
101. Sip a cup of Christmas cocoa at the Tree Lighting before you stroll down Zilker Park’s Trail of Lights
102. enjoy a tasty taco at Torchy’s Tacos at the Trailer Park South 1st location
103. Enjoy a fish bowl at Hula-Hut on Lake Austin
